SummaryA Solder Operator III responsible for precisely joining metal components together using a soldering iron or other heating equipment, by applying solder to create electrical or mechanical connections, following detailed instructions and quality standards, working on printed circuit boards (PCBs) and assembling electronic components Job Description

Key responsibilities of a soldering operator include:

  • Preparing components: Cleaning and prepping components to be soldered, including applying flux as needed.
  • Reading blueprints and work orders: Interpreting assembly drawings and specifications to understand soldering requirements for each project.
  • Operating soldering equipment: Using various soldering tools like soldering irons, hot air guns, wave soldering machines, and selective soldering machines with proper technique.
  • Soldering components: Precisely placing and soldering electronic components onto PCBs, including through-hole and surface mount components.
  • Quality inspection: Visually inspecting soldered joints for defects like cold solder, bridging, or improper placement, and performing necessary rework.
  • Maintaining equipment: Cleaning and maintaining soldering tools and equipment to ensure optimal performance.
  • Following safety protocols: Adhering to safety guidelines regarding handling hazardous materials like flux and solder fumes.
  • Documentation: Maintaining records of production details, including quality control checks and any issues encountered.

SKILLS, KNOWLEDGE AND CERTIFICATIONS

Required skills and qualifications:

  • Experience: Should have 4+ years of PCB solder experience. Should be trained in IPC 610
  • Fine motor skills: Excellent hand-eye coordination and dexterity for precise placement of components.
  • Technical knowledge: Understanding of basic electronics, circuit diagrams, and soldering techniques.
  • Attention to detail: Ability to identify even minor defects in soldering work.
  • Ability to follow instructions: Carefully adhering to established procedures and specifications.
  • Visual acuity: Good eyesight for close-up work and inspecting small components.
